The Minimax CU 300C is a universal combination woodworking machine that integrates jointing, planing, sawing, and spindle moulding functionality into a single compact unit, designed specifically for craftsmen and small-to-medium workshops processing solid wood. This multi-function approach eliminates the need for separate machines while maintaining the precision and reliability expected in professional joinery and furniture production environments.
The machine's technical architecture centers on three primary work units: a 300mm wide jointer cutterhead with a 1510mm bed length for face and edge jointing, a parallel fence rip capacity of 820mm coupled with a 1600-2600mm sliding table for crosscutting, and a spindle moulder with variable speeds from 1700 to 9000 rpm accommodating tools up to 210mm diameter. The cutterhead employs a 72mm Cutterlock system with three standard 300x30x3mm knives, enabling efficient stock removal and consistent surface finishes. Power delivery across all three units comes from three single-phase motors totaling 4.8 Hp, making the CU 300C compatible with standard workshop electrical infrastructure without requiring three-phase installation.
This machine targets professional craftsmen and small production workshops (typically 3-15 employees) processing solid wood stock for furniture components, cabinet parts, and custom millwork where floor space is limited but operational versatility is essential. The combination of jointing for face and edge preparation, precision saw capacity for ripping and crosscutting up to 100mm projection, and integral moulding capability at variable spindle speeds enables single-operator workflow for small-batch production runs and made-to-order work, particularly in European and North American craft-focused woodworking sectors.

Applications
custom millwork
small workshopCraftsmen producing custom door frames, window casings, and architectural trim components use the CU 300C to prepare rough lumber through jointing (300mm width), rip and crosscut components on the integrated saw (820mm rip capacity), and execute moulding profiles on the spindle unit at 4000-7000 rpm. A single operator can manage the complete machining sequence for architectural components from raw stock to finished profile in one workstation.
timber construction
medium workshopTimber frame and structural woodworking shops employ the CU 300C for preparing and dressing solid timber components prior to assembly. The jointing unit flattens and squares edges on substantial stock, the saw unit with 1600-2600mm sliding table crosscuts to precise lengths, and the spindle moulding capability creates decorative or functional profiles on beams and structural members at lower production volumes than dedicated line systems.
cabinet making
medium workshopMedium-sized cabinet shops utilize the CU 300C as a primary preparation and moulding station for solid wood face frames, doors, and interior components. The machine's ability to joint wide stock (300mm), rip components up to 820mm, and produce consistent moulding profiles at selectable spindle speeds (1700-9000 rpm) supports batch production workflows for semi-custom residential and commercial cabinetry without requiring multiple dedicated machines.
solid wood crafting
small workshopSmall furniture makers and wood artisans rely on the CU 300C's combination functionality to process solid wood panels and components for tables, cabinets, and decorative pieces. The 1510mm jointer bed ensures flat reference surfaces, the 820mm rip capacity handles standard panel widths, and the variable-speed spindle (1700-9000 rpm) enables both heavy routing and fine detail work on edge profiles and decorative elements.
